Man Charged for Selling Fake Car Insurance | Toronto News
A 25-year-old ex-insurance agent, Muhammad Raahim, has been charged with defrauding the public by selling fake car insurance across the Greater Toronto Area — swindling victims out of over $10,000 in bogus policies. Despite losing his license, he allegedly continued selling forged documents. Arrested in August, he’s now on bail and facing court — a stark warning to everyone: always verify that your insurer is licensed before you pay.
